Overview
ES-Group is a Cyprus-registered entity that presents itself as an online trading provider. It was founded in November 2020 and operates under the domain es-group.org. Based on official records, the company claims no regulatory authorisation from any financial supervisory authority, and its instrument offering is not publicly listed.
Despite its registration in Cyprus—a jurisdiction home to many CySEC-regulated brokers—ES-Group does not hold a CySEC licence or any other known regulatory credential. This absence of oversight places the firm in a high-risk category for traders who prioritise regulatory protection.
Regulation and Safety
Our research confirms that ES-Group currently has no confirmed regulatory licences. While the company is registered as a legal entity in Cyprus, registration does not equate to financial regulation. Traders are therefore not covered by investor compensation schemes or dispute resolution mechanisms typical of regulated brokers.
The lack of transparency regarding the company's ownership, management, and operational history further amplifies caution. For safety-conscious traders, the absence of independent oversight is a significant red flag.
Account Types and Trading Conditions
ES-Group offers three account tiers: Start, Progressive, and Premium. The Start account requires a minimum deposit of $150 and provides maximum leverage of 1:100. The Progressive account requires a $1,000 minimum deposit and also offers 1:100 leverage. The Premium account demands a substantial $10,000 minimum deposit and allows leverage up to 1:500.
These tiers appear designed to cater to different capital levels, from retail beginners to high-net-worth individuals. The high leverage available on the Premium account suggests a focus on aggressive trading strategies, but also magnifies risk.
